Early on, Darren dispel The Vampires Assistant is the second instalment in the saga of Darren Shan, which began with Cirque du Freak . Then, Darren made the difficult decision to become a half-vampire to save his best mate Steve Leopards life. Now, he must leave his friends and family behind as he travels cross-country with the vampire Mr Crepsley and the Cirque du Freak. Early on, Darren dispels the vampire myth in his typically facetious fashion: Crosses and holy water didnt hurt us. All garlic did was give us bad breath ... A stake through the heart would kill us, of course, but so would a bullet or a knife or electricity ... We were tougher to kill than normal people, but we werent indestructible. However, despite Darrens seeming flippancy, The Vampires Assistant is not for the squeamish or faint-hearted. How long can Darren go before he must drink human blood? How safe are Darrens new-found friends? Why dont the mysterious, blue-hooded dwarves speak or cry out in pain? And does their master Mr Des Tiny really feed on little children? No one is safe in this gruesome, macabre tale--more a whos-going-to-do-what than a who-dunnit: And then the red monster was on him. Stanley opened his mouth to scream, but before he could, the monsters hands--claws?--clamped over his mouth. There was a brief struggle, then Stanley was sliding to the floor, unconscious, unseeing, unknowing. Familiar characters include Mr Tall, the wolf-man and Evra, the snake boy, who are more fleshed out in this follow-up. New characters include Darrens new mate Sam and R G (Reggie Veggie), an ecowarrior. If book one whet your appetite, then The Vampires Assistant will certainly leave you hungry for more. Watch out for the next fang-tastic sequel. --Nicola Perry
